Strike Back tells the story of Section 20, a covert unit with the British Defence Intelligence who works all over the world to gather intelligence and eliminate threats among other tasks. A joint venture between America’s Cinemax and the UK’s Sky One in the form of a thrilling, action-filled TV series that premiered in 2010 and concluded its eighth season run in 2020.
